概括
浸泡肺 (IPE) 是一个严重的潜水风险. 军事潜水员在强度炼期间会经历IPE,而老年休潜水员患有并发症也面临风险.

背景情况:
- 沉浸性肺 (IPE) 是一种可能致命的潜水事故,具有重大的心肺呼吸系统后果.
- 在军事学员和休潜水员中描述IPE病例对于了解风险因素至关重要.
- 之前的研究强调需要将IPE发生与暴露和个人背景因素 (如年龄和并发症) 联系起来.
研究的目的:
- 在军事学员和休潜水员中描述浸泡肺水腫 (IPE) 病例.
- 将IPE发生与特定暴露和个别背景因素联系起来.
- 为了比较军事和娱乐潜水群体之间的IPE特征.
主要方法:
- 在2017年1月至2019年8月期间接受治疗的57名IPE患者的医疗记录和潜水参数的回顾性分析.
- 将患者分为两组:军事训练 (n=14) 和休潜水 (n=43).
- 两组之间的年龄,暴露和并发症因素的比较.
主要成果:
- 在40%的病例中,IPE发生在强度体力炼后,在军事潜水员 (86%) 显著高于休潜水员 (26%).
- 在40岁以下的休潜水员中没有观察到IPE病例;研究中的军事潜水员都在40岁以下.
- 虽然症状强度相似,但休潜水员的住院时间较长.
结论:
- 在年轻,健康的个体中,强烈的体力活动是IPE的关键,由于呼吸系统的限制,经常在军事潜水中看到.
- 与军事潜水员相比,IPE的休潜水员年龄较大,具有更多的并发症,并经历较低的环境压力因素.
- 在军事和娱乐潜水环境之间,IPE风险因素有很大差异,需要定制的预防策略.

Diagnosing Pulmonary EmbolismDiagnosing pulmonary embolism (PE) involves clinical assessment and advanced imaging tests. The preferred diagnostic tool is the spiral (helical) CT scan or CT angiography (CTA), which uses intravenous contrast media to visualize the pulmonary vasculature and identify emboli.A ventilation-perfusion (V/Q) scan is an alternative for patients unable to receive contrast media. Pneumothorax is a medical condition defined by the buildup of air in the pleural space between the lungs and the chest wall. This accumulation of air can lead to partial or complete lung collapse, resulting in a range of clinical manifestations.
